There are many who actually think similar to you and consider it as a very complex procedure. In fact, when you perform task like migrating GroupWise email environment to Exchange Server platform, you may always come across various problems.  Just for an example- if you use the Microsoft Exchange Connector for Novell GroupWise, probability to get encountered with the following error messages:&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Event ID: 6062&lt;br /&gt;Source: MSExchangeGwRtr&lt;br /&gt;Fail on dispatching message&lt;br /&gt;'\\EXCHSRVR\connect$\exchconn\gwrouter\MEX2GW\74f3fd1b.api' from '\\EXCHSRVR\connect$\exchconn\gwrouter\MEX2GW\'&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Event ID: 6066&lt;br /&gt;Source: MSExchangeGwRtr&lt;br /&gt;Trying to move file '\\EXCHSRVR\connect$\exchconn\gwrouter\MEX2GW\74f3fd1b.api' to '\\EXCHSRVR\connect$\exchconn\gwrouter\badfiles\'&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Event ID: 6067&lt;br /&gt;Source: MSExchangeGwRtr&lt;br /&gt;Failed to move file '\\NWSERVER\data\office41\gwdomain\wpgate\api41\API_IN\7524ce6c' to '\\NWSERVER\data\office41\gwdomain\wpgate\api41\API_IN\7524cef3.api'&lt;br /&gt;The system error code is 3&lt;br /&gt;The system cannot find the path specified.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Event ID: 6067&lt;br /&gt;Source: MSExchangeGwRtr&lt;br /&gt;Failed to move file '\\NWSERVER\data\office41\gwdomain\wpgate\api41\API_IN\7520b4a7' to '\\NWSERVER\data\office41\gwdomain\wpgate\api41\API_IN\7520b4f7.api'&lt;br /&gt;The system error code is 32&lt;br /&gt;The process cannot access the file because&lt;br /&gt;it is being used by another process.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Event ID: 6067&lt;br /&gt;Source: MSExchangeGwRtr Failed to move file '\\EXCHSRVR\connect$\exchconn\gwrouter\MEX2GW\7521dff8.api' to '\\EXCHSRVR\connect$\exchconn\gwrouter\badfiles\7521e068'&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The system error code is 2&lt;br /&gt;The system cannot find the file specified.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Reasons behind occurrence of aforementioned error messages&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Now there are many reasons for receiving the aforementioned errors:&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;    * Slow or infrequent connectivity to the Novell Server.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;    * Unable to access the required file due to an antivirus program.  &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;* Files getting locked due to some other process trying to access the files at the same time as the Exchange Connector for Novell GroupWise.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Now when these event IDs occur, the probability is always high that you will not be able to export email messages from GroupWise to Exchange Server.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;span style="font-weight: bold;"&gt;Resolution&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;To overcome from these sorts of issues, you need to make some amendments in settings of GWROUTER service, which is usually meant to transfer email messages from Exchange to the API_IN and ATT_IN folders in the API gateway on the Novell Server. Therefore, the best step that you can take is just renaming the file from xxxxxxxx to xxxxxxxx.api. This small step will enable the GroupWise message transfer agent (MTA) to pick up the message. In fact, many organizations make use of migration wizard for this purpose. One of the most frequently used migrations is Lotus Notes to Exchange using migration wizard for Exchange 2000. However, when you use Exchange migration wizard, you may possibly notice that task information is not migrated correctly and completely from Lotus Notes to Exchange Server mailboxes. In simple terms,  when you as an individual export Lotus Notes users’ calendar information, email messages,  and task information right from calendar to Exchange 2000 Server by making use of  Migration Wizard for Exchange 2000, the chances are always high that you  may find fault that some of your  tasks have been imported to your Outlook Tasks folder.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;span style="font-weight: bold;"&gt;Now you might be questioning –what could be reasons?&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;You need to understand the fact that the Migration Wizard generally exports the tasks that are included in the Lotus Notes calendar. But its operation mode is very different. In fact, it works in a different way in migrating tasks for Lotus Notes R5 version and Lotus Notes 4.6 version. Consider the following aspects:&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;1. In a Notes 4.6 mailbox database, there is a Display task on my calendar option for each task. By default, a task is not displayed in the calendar.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;2. A Notes 4.6 mailbox database does not have this option; it is set up in the preferences for all of the tasks instead of for each individual task, but it causes the same problem.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;span style="font-weight: bold;"&gt;Resolution&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Now suppose you  are using Notes 4.6 version then the best thing or procedure that you can follow  on the tasks for migrating calendar items could be:&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;a). Open your Notes mailbox in your Notes 4.6x client.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;b). Change to the “To Do” folder.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;c). Open an existing task that was not migrated.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;d). Click the Display task on my calendar button. The button will then change to remove from calendar.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;e). Save the task.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;f). Run Migration Wizard for Exchange 2000 again. The task is migrated to Exchange 2000.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;span style="font-weight: bold;"&gt;Now, just in case if you are  not successful in achieving your task by doing this way, then you must start considering third party tool for Notes to Exchange migration.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;All you require is just follow the below given steps for migrating tasks of Lotus Notes R5 calendar to Exchange Server 2000:&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;a). Open your Notes mailbox within a Notes R5 client.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;b). Change to the “To-Do” section, and then click Preferences on the Tools menu.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;c). On the Calendar tab, click the To Do tab.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;d). Click to select the Always show current to do's in today's calendar check box.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;e). Click the OK button.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;f). Run Migration Wizard for Exchange 2000 again. The task is now migrated to Exchange 2000.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t; You must understand that incomplete migration very frequently results in the loss of data.
